This year at DigiPen Institute of Technology, we project that on average students will pay $49,500, while the advertised price of attendance is $70,249. That’s a difference of $20,749.

How much a student actually pays usually depends, at least in part, on their family's household income. At DigiPen Institute of Technology this year, we project students with incomes over $110K will pay around $62,341, while students with incomes below $30K will pay around $33,594. That's a difference of $28,747.

Graduation Rates

A school’s graduation rate can indicate how likely a student is to complete their degree. At DigiPen Institute of Technology, over the last five years 57% of students earned their bachelor’s degree within six years of enrolling.

Student Retention

Student retention, or how often students return to continue their degree after completing their first year, is another helpful indicator. Over the last five years, at DigiPen Institute of Technology, about 74% of full-time students returned the following fall to continue their degree.
